当前位置: 首页 > news >正文

软件评测师基础知识专项刷题:软件测试过程

前言

软考软件评测师备考之路,基础刷题必不可少。本文围绕软件测试过程模块整理经典习题 + 核心考点梳理,系列内容长期连载更新,慢慢积累、逐个突破,轻松夯实应试功底。

考点

测试过程模型

1.组织级测试过程

  • 组织级测试过程用于开发和管理组织级测试规格说明。这些规格说明通常不面向具体项目,而是适用于整个组织的测试,常见的组织级测试规格说明包括组织级测试方针和组织级测试策略。
  • 组织级测试方针是一个执行级文档,描述组织内的测试目的、目标和总体范围。
  • 组织级测试策略是一个详细的技术性文档,它定义了如何在组织内执行测试。它不是针对特定的项目,而是一个通用文档,为组织中的许多项目提供指导。
  • 组织级测试过程包含了组织级测试规格说明的建立、评审和维护活动,还涵盖了对组织依从性的监测
  • 组织级测试过程的目的是制定、监测符合性并维护组织级测试规格说明,例如组织级测试方针和组织级测试策略。

2.测试管理过程

(1)测试策划过程

  • 测试策划过程用于制定测试计划。
  • 测试策划过程的目的是确定测试范围和方法。

(2)测试设计和实现过程

  • 测试设计和实现过程用于获取测试用例和测试规程,通常记录在测试规格说明中,但可能会立即执行。
  • 测试设计和实现过程的目的是导出将在测试执行过程中所执行的测试规程。

(3)测试环境构建和维护过程

  • 测试环境构建和维护过程用于建立和维护测试执行的环境。
  • 测试环境构建和维护过程的目的是建立和维护所需的测试环境,并将其状态传达给所有利益相关方。

(4)测试执行过程

  • 测试执行过程是在测试环境构建和维护过程所建立的测试环境上运行测试设计和实现过程产生的测试规程。
  • 测试执行过程的目的是在准备好的测试环境中执行测试设计和实现过程中创建的测试规程,并记录结果。

(5)测试事件报告过程

  • 测试事件报告过程用于报告测试事件。
  • 测试事件报告过程的目的是向利益相关方报告需要通过测试执行确定进一步操作的事件。

(6)测试监测和控制过程

  • 测试监测和控制过程检查测试是否按照测试计划以及组织级测试规格说明(例如组织级测试方针、组织级测试策略)进行。
  • 测试监测和控制过程的目的是确定测试进度能否按照测试计划以及组织级测试规格说明(例如组织级测试方针、组织级测试策略)进行。

(7)测试完成过程

  • 测试完成过程是在测试活动完成后执行的。它用于对特定测试阶段(例如系统测试)或测试类型(例如性能测试),以及完整项目的测试的总结。
  • 测试完成过程的目的是提供有用的测试资产供以后使用,使测试环境保持在令人满意的状态,记录测试结果并将其传达给利益相关方。测试资产包括测试计划、测试用例说明、测试脚本、测试工具、测试数据和测试环境基础设施。

3.静态测试过程

  • 静态测试是在不运行代码的情况下,通过一组质量准则或其他准则对测试项进行检查的测试,也常称为审查、走查或检查。静态测试既包括人工进行代码审查,也包括使用静态分析工具在不运行代码的前提下发现代码和文档中的缺陷(例如编译器、圈复杂度分析器,或代码的安全分析器)。
  • 目的:通过人工或工具进行代码走查、技术评审等活动,发现软件需求规格说明、软件设计说明、概要设计、详细设计、变更、软件用户手册等文档和源代码等工作产品中存在的问题。
  • 静态测试的输入可包括:

(1)包含需求规格说明、软件设计说明在内的产品说明文档。
(2)包含用户使用于册、使用帮助在内的用户文档集。
(3)软件源代码。

  • 静态测试活动分为计划、启动评审、个人评审、问题交流与分析、修正和报告。
刷题区
题1

以下选项中,()不属于测试管理过程中的过程。

A.测试完成过程

B.测试监测和控制过程

C.测试事件报告过程

D.组织级测试过程

答案D

解析:ABC为测试管理过程

题2

以下不属于测试过程管理中过程的是()。

A.测试策划过程:

B.测试设计和实现过程

C.测试执行过程

D.静态测试过程

答案D

解析:D为测试管理过程模型

题3

以下有关测试过程和管理的叙述中,不正确的是().

A.组织级测试过程用于开发和管理组织级测试规格说明,这些规格说明通常不面向具体项目,而是适用于整个组织的测

试。

B.测试策划过程的目的是确定测试范围和方法,并与利益相关方达成共识,以便及早识别测试资源、测试环境以及其

他要求。

C.测试监测和控制过程的目的是确定测试进度能否按照测试计划以及组织级测试规格说明进行。

D.动态测试既包括人工进行代码审查,也包括使用动态分析工具在不运行代码的前提下发现代码和文档中的缺陷。

答案D

题4

下面有关测试管理组点描述中错误的是()

  1. 评审小组可由业务人员,开发人员等组成,用户不能参与。
  2. 测试小组实行“组长负责制”,负责工作安排,对整个测试过程和产品质量进行总结和评价。
  3. 评审小组负责软件定义评审,软件需求评审,详细设计评审,软件实现评审和软件验收评审D. 支持小组负责网络管理,数据备份,文档管理,设备管理和维护,员工内部培训。

答案A

解析:需要包括用户

题5

成立测试管理小组可以对测试进行统一、规范的管理。测试管理组不包括()

A.评审小组

B.测试小组

C.开发小组

D.支持小组

答案C

总结

以上就是本次软件评测师「软件测试过程」基础知识的刷题练习与考点梳理啦~

如果本篇软件评测师「软件测试过程」基础知识刷题内容对你备考有所帮助,欢迎点赞👍、收藏⭐、关注一波!

http://www.jsqmd.com/news/585486/

相关文章:

  • ReTerraForged地形引擎完全指南:解锁5种高级地形生成技术
  • 如何用OpenCore Legacy Patcher让旧款Mac焕发新生:终极完整指南
  • 万象视界灵坛在工业质检中的应用:缺陷图像零样本语义归因分析案例
  • 如何用统一权限体系,支撑指标体系从建设到落地的全流程治理
  • 【数据治理实践】第 14 期:数据的免疫体系——数据质量管理框架
  • 科哥镜像实测:CAM++说话人识别系统快速部署与核心功能体验
  • JAVA重点基础、进阶知识及易错点总结(25)Lambda 表达式
  • WPS-Zotero:跨平台文献管理的革新解决方案
  • 如何快速解决腾讯游戏卡顿问题:ACE-Guard资源限制器完整指南
  • 4个关键步骤:使用OpenCore Legacy Patcher免费升级旧款Mac的完整指南
  • 3个革命性的突破:douyin-downloader全场景应用赋能内容价值挖掘
  • Janus-Pro-7B文生图作品展:中国风角色、科幻机甲、自然生态高清图集
  • Nunchaku FLUX.1-dev 开发环境配置:Anaconda虚拟环境创建与管理指南
  • 网盘直链下载工具:突破限制的多平台文件获取解决方案
  • Nano-Banana Studio入门必看:SDXL模型量化与推理加速实践
  • AI编程新范式:基于MogFace模型能力开发自定义视觉自动化脚本
  • 微信小程序导入 WeUI 的详细方式及具体步骤
  • MouseClick鼠标连点器:告别重复点击,让效率翻倍的神器
  • OpenCore Legacy Patcher终极方案:让老旧Mac焕发新生的完整实战指南
  • 如何突破原神性能瓶颈?开源帧率增强工具的创新解决方案
  • 美国EECS强校观察:MIT+Berkeley+Cornell
  • 收藏!大模型入行全攻略|程序员/小白零踩坑转岗+学习指南
  • 5分钟搞定QQ音乐加密文件:qmc-decoder终极解密指南
  • 如何高效解锁《原神》帧率限制:完整技术指南与实战配置
  • OpenClaw+Phi-3-vision-128k-instruct极客玩法:AR眼镜实时视觉辅助系统
  • Unity中设计模式
  • Jetbrains官宣下一代构建工具!
  • SEO_10个实用的SEO优化技巧,快速提升网站排名
  • Windows任务栏透明化神器:TranslucentTB让你的桌面瞬间高级
  • Phi-3-mini-128k-instruct应用场景:数据分析师自然语言转Python代码助手